Understanding the Different Types of Eye Wrinkles
Before we can effectively address eye area concerns, we must understand what we are observing in the mirror. Not all wrinkles are created equal, and their causes vary from physiological changes to environmental stressors.
Dynamic Wrinkles
Dynamic wrinkles are those that appear only when we make facial expressions. When you smile, laugh, or squint, the muscles around your eyes contract, causing the skin to fold. In youthful skin, these lines disappear as soon as the face relaxes. However, because we repeat these expressions thousands of times throughout our lives, these temporary folds can eventually transition into more permanent features. Static Wrinkles
Static wrinkles are the lines that remain visible even when your face is completely at rest. These are often the result of the natural aging process, where the production of essential proteins like collagen and elastin begins to slow down. External factors such as UV exposure, pollution, and smoking accelerate this process by breaking down the skin's structural support system. Around the eyes, static wrinkles often manifest as "etched" lines that don't bounce back as they once did.
Wrinkle Folds
Wrinkle folds are deeper grooves that usually occur due to a loss of underlying volume. As we age, the fat pads beneath the skin may shift or diminish, and the skin begins to sag. This creates deeper creases, such as those in the "tear trough" area or the hollows beneath the lower lids. Addressing these requires a focus on both surface hydration and deeper firming support.
Why the Eye Area is So Vulnerable
The skin surrounding the eyes is uniquely challenging for a few key reasons. First, it is roughly ten times thinner than the skin on the rest of the face. It also contains very few sebaceous glands, which means it lacks the natural oils that keep other parts of the face naturally moisturized and protected.
Furthermore, the eyes are in constant motion. We blink upwards of 10,000 times a day, and the muscles around the eyes are some of the most active in the entire body. This combination of thin skin, lack of natural moisture, and constant mechanical stress makes the eye contour the most frequent site for early signs of aging.

Hyaluronic Acid: The Master Hydrator
Hyaluronic acid is a molecule naturally found in our skin that can hold up to 1,000 times its weight in water. Because the eye area is so prone to dehydration, topically applying hyaluronic acid can "plump" the appearance of the skin from within, making fine lines look less noticeable almost instantly. Peptides: The Messengers
Peptides are short chains of amino acids that act as building blocks for proteins like collagen. In skincare, specific peptides are used to "signal" the skin to behave in a more youthful manner. Vitamin C: The Brightener and Protector
Vitamin C is a potent antioxidant that helps neutralize free radicals caused by sun exposure and pollution. For the eye area, it serves a dual purpose: it helps brighten the appearance of dark circles and supports the skin's natural collagen, which can help reduce the look of fine lines over time.
Vitamin A (Retinoids): The Gold Standard
Vitamin A derivatives are widely recognized by dermatologists for their ability to encourage cell turnover and improve skin density. Lifestyle Habits for Youthful Eyes
While topical products are essential, they work best when supported by healthy lifestyle choices. The eye area is a barometer for your overall health, and small changes can yield visible improvements.
- Prioritize Sleep: During sleep, the body undergoes its most significant repair processes. Aim for 7-9 hours of quality rest.
- Sleep on Your Back: Sleeping on your side or stomach can press your face into the pillow, creating "sleep wrinkles" that can become permanent over time. Consider a silk or satin pillowcase to reduce friction if you find it difficult to stay on your back.
- Hydrate Internally: Topical hydration is vital, but drinking enough water ensures that your skin cells remain plump from the inside out.
- Wear Sunglasses: This isn't just a fashion choice; it’s a preventative skincare measure. Large, UV-rated sunglasses prevent the repetitive squinting that leads to dynamic wrinkles and protect the skin from UV-induced collagen breakdown.
- Manage Salt Intake: High sodium levels can lead to fluid retention, which manifests as puffiness under the eyes. This puffiness stretches the skin over time, potentially leading to more wrinkles.

How long does it take to see results from an eye cream?
Skincare is a commitment, and real results come with consistency over time. While hydrating products can provide an immediate "plumping" effect that makes fine lines look smoother, more significant improvements in the appearance of static wrinkles typically take 4 to 8 weeks of twice-daily use. This timeframe aligns with the natural cycle of skin cell renewal and the time required for ingredients like peptides to support the skin's structure.
